First, we assess your site properly. Not just measurements—we look at drainage patterns, existing base conditions, and how water moves around your property. If the foundation isn’t right, the best asphalt in the world won’t save you.
Next comes the actual paving. We use hot mix asphalt designed specifically for New Jersey’s climate, applied at engineered thickness. Our equipment ensures uniform distribution and proper compaction—the step that separates professional work from amateur attempts.
The compaction process eliminates air voids and creates density that resists water infiltration. This is what keeps your driveway intact through winter freeze-thaw cycles instead of cracking and failing like improperly installed surfaces.

Professional asphalt paving in Sparta lasts 15-20 years when installed correctly and maintained properly. The key is using asphalt mixes designed for New Jersey’s freeze-thaw cycles and ensuring proper drainage from day one.
Poor installation cuts this lifespan dramatically. We’ve seen DIY jobs and cheap contractor work fail within 2-3 years because they skipped proper base preparation or used inappropriate materials for our climate.
Our installations use Sussex County-specific mix designs and include detailed maintenance guidance. Regular sealcoating every 2-3 years protects your investment and can extend your pavement’s life well beyond the typical range.
It depends on your foundation and the extent of damage. If you have minor surface cracks but a solid base underneath, resurfacing with a new asphalt layer can extend your driveway’s life at about half the cost of replacement.
Full replacement becomes necessary when you have foundation problems, extensive cracking, or drainage issues that cause repeated failures. We remove everything, fix the base properly, and install new pavement designed to last.
We evaluate your existing conditions, drainage patterns, and damage type to recommend the most cost-effective solution. Sometimes spending more upfront saves significant money long-term by addressing root problems instead of just symptoms.
Asphalt paving in Sparta typically runs $7-15 per square foot, with most residential driveways averaging around $4,740 total. Your specific cost depends on site conditions, required thickness, drainage work, and accessibility challenges.
Factors that increase cost include removing existing surfaces, repairing damaged bases, installing new drainage systems, or working around landscaping and utilities. Straightforward installations on well-prepared sites cost less.

The best time for asphalt paving in New Jersey is late spring through early fall when temperatures stay consistently above 50°F. Hot mix asphalt needs warm conditions for proper installation and compaction.
We schedule most projects between April and October, but exact timing depends on weather conditions rather than calendar dates. Cold weather prevents proper compaction and affects surface quality—we won’t compromise your results for convenience.

Most residential driveway projects in Sparta don’t require permits, but work affecting drainage, connecting to public roads, or involving significant grading might need township approval.
Commercial projects, large parking lots, or work in sensitive areas like wetlands or historic districts typically require permits. Sparta Township has specific requirements we navigate regularly.

Start by avoiding heavy traffic for 48-72 hours while your new asphalt fully cures. During hot weather, keep vehicles off the surface when asphalt can soften and show tire marks or indentations.
Regular maintenance includes cleaning oil stains immediately, sealing minor cracks before they expand, and applying professional sealcoating every 2-3 years. Sealcoating protects against UV damage, water infiltration, and chemical spills.
Keep drainage working properly—clean gutters, ensure water flows away from the pavement, and address any settling issues quickly. Small problems become expensive repairs when ignored. We provide complete maintenance guidelines with every installation.
